The Highland Soap Co.®
One of Fort William's very specialist shops offering Scottish handmade soaps and natural skin care. Our cold-processed soaps are handmade in the Scottish Highlands by century’s old traditional processes using only the purest and finest natural ingredients. With many of the precious oils, butters and plant ingredients used being grown organically or wild-harvested. Our retail workshops are located in Spean Bridge and Fort William, in the heart of the Scottish Highlands. You'll find us next to the Spean Bridge Mill with free car/coach parking, and on the High Street in Fort William. The Granite House
THE GRANITE HOUSE on Fort William High Street has been serving locals and visitors with the very best gifts since 1977. From our early days as a small souvenir store we have expanded to 8 departments over 2 floors. Traditional & contemporary jewellery from Scottish and International designers Watches from STORM, ICE, TIMEX, CASIO, LORUS and others. Plus a strap & Battery fitting service Collectable Giftware and functional ceramics from ENESCO, PORTMIERION, LSA, HIGHLAND STONEWARE and others. Fun & Funky gifts for friends and family of all ages Kitchenware from the coolest on trend designers, JOSEPH JOSEPH, ZEAL, LSA and more. Clothing from JOULES, SEASALT, WHITE STUFF, NESS, ANIMAL, WEIRD FISH, OLD GUYS RULE and our in house T shirt designs. WE even have a small musical instruments and Folk CD department, and a great selection of KIDS TOYS. Also upstairs you'll find an area dedicated to beautifying your home, with retro signs, YANKEE candles and useful gifts from around the World Finally, tucked away in a corner is our unique selection of several thousand secondhand books. House of Clan Jamfrie
One of Fort William's specialist retail gift shops - we have lots of quality souvenirs and a great selection of Scotch whisky - in miniature bottles, which make great gifts. Our art gallery has a selection of Highland paintings and photographs both framed or unframed. We have lots of quality Highland garments for cold and wet weather, so please come in and browse when you are in town. Clan Jamfrie was established in 2003 and was immediately successful due to its eclectic variety of goods ranging from Shelia Fleet Jewellery to clothing from Harris Tweed Co, this bringing the best of the Scottish Isles to its customers. Add to this the largest selection of leather handbags in the Highlands and our renowned Whisky Centre where the best malts produced in Scotland can be purchased at arguably the cheapest prices in Fort William.  These few words do not begin to do justice to our complete range of products but a visit within our site will give a flavour of what we are about. The upstairs gallery was opened in 2005 showcasing local original artwork, and over 100 framed prints, limited editions and often with unframed prints also available. A range of furniture from Voyage Maison is also available.
